Popular Turkish Wedding Traditions Explained

Attending a Turkish wedding? Here's a glimpse into some traditional customs you might encounter.

Flag-Planting

The groom participates in the "flag-planting" ceremony at dawn on his wedding day. This ritual involves gathering male members of the wedding party to offer prayers and plant a flag on the highest point near the couple's home.

Bride Pickup Tradition

Before leaving her home the bride takes a moment to look into a mirror and envision her journey ahead towards a happy, long marriage. Afterwards, she is escorted from her family's residence by car or horse and carriage, accompanied by the lively sounds of Davul Zurna music. As she begins this journey the bride proudly waves the Turkish flag, a symbolic gift from her groom.

Wedding Superstition

In a brief ceremony conducted by a witness and local authority the bride and groom exchange vows and engage in a tradition where they step on each other's feet. This custom is believed to signify which partner will have the final say in the marriage, depending on who steps on the other's foot first.

Wedding Reception Traditions

At the reception guests take part in a tradition where they pin gold coins or money onto the red ribbon wrapped around the bride. The bride also writes the names of unmarried women on her shoe and the first name to fade indicates the next woman who will marry
